What Legally Constitutes a DUI in Burbank, IL?

In Burbank, IL, a DUI isn’t limited to someone “feeling drunk.” Under Illinois law, you can be charged if police believe alcohol, drugs, or any intoxicating substance affected your ability to drive safely.

DUI laws in Illinois apply not only to alcohol, but also to drug-related impairment. This includes illegal substances, cannabis, and even legally prescribed medications if they interfere with a person’s ability to drive safely.

Importantly, a BAC of .08% is not required for an arrest. Prosecutors can pursue DUI charges if law enforcement believes your mental or physical abilities were affected by alcohol, drugs, or a combination of substances—even without chemical test results above the legal limit.

Types of DUI Charges in Burbank, IL

Drivers arrested for DUI in Burbank, IL may face different charges depending on the details of the incident, their prior record, and whether the alleged conduct caused injury. The following are some of the DUI offenses most frequently prosecuted in Burbank, IL:

Burbank, IL First-Time DUI (Class A Misdemeanor)

A first-time DUI offense in Burbank, IL is typically charged as a Class A misdemeanor. A conviction can carry penalties of up to 1 year in jail, fines up to $2,500, a mandatory minimum one-year revocation of your driver’s license, and required completion of alcohol education classes or treatment programs.

Felony DUI (Aggravated DUI) in Burbank, IL (Felony)

Certain circumstances allow prosecutors to pursue aggravated DUI, which is treated as a felony offense in Burbank, IL. These charges typically arise when the alleged conduct involves more serious factors, such as:

  • Driving under the influence while a minor passenger is present.
  • Allegations that impaired driving caused serious injury or a fatal crash.
  • Accumulating three or more prior DUI convictions.
  • Driving while your driver’s license was suspended or revoked.

Because aggravated DUI is a felony, the potential penalties are much harsher than those for misdemeanor DUI charges. These cases can involve prison sentences, extended probation, significant financial penalties, and long-term or permanent loss of driving privileges.

Second and Subsequent DUI Offenses in Burbank, IL

A second or third DUI conviction in Burbank, IL carries significantly harsher consequences. Penalties may include extended jail sentences, longer periods of driver’s license revocation, and more restrictive probation or court supervision requirements.

Burbank, IL DUI with a Minor Passenger

Driving under the influence with a minor passenger in Burbank, IL can lead to enhanced penalties. Courts may impose additional fines, mandatory community service, and in some circumstances the offense can be prosecuted as a felony.

DUI Resulting in Injury or Fatality in Burbank, IL

If an alleged DUI crash in Burbank, IL causes serious bodily injury, permanent disability, or death, prosecutors may pursue aggravated DUI charges. These cases carry the risk of lengthy prison sentences and significant long-term legal consequences.

Burbank, IL Drug-Related DUI Charges

Drivers in Burbank, IL can also be charged with DUI if drugs affect their ability to drive safely. This can involve illegal drugs, prescription medications, cannabis, or even certain over-the-counter substances that impair judgment or coordination.

DUI Charges for CDL Holders in Burbank, IL

Drivers with a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) face stricter DUI rules in Illinois. A first CDL DUI offense can result in a one-year suspension of commercial driving privileges—even if the incident occurred in a personal vehicle. A second offense can lead to permanent CDL disqualification, and commercial drivers must stay below a .04% BAC when operating a commercial vehicle.


DUI Penalties in Burbank, IL

The consequences for a DUI conviction in Burbank, IL vary based on whether the charge involves a first-time offense, a prior DUI history, or an aggravated circumstance. Potential penalties may include incarceration, significant fines, suspension or revocation of driving privileges, and lasting effects on your criminal record, driver’s license status, and insurance rates.

Summary of DUI Penalties in Burbank, IL

DUI Offense Potential Penalties
First DUI (Class A Misdemeanor) – Up to 1 year in jail
– Fines up to $2,500
– Minimum 1-year license revocation
– Mandatory alcohol education or treatment
– Possible installation of BAIID
Second DUI – Minimum 5 days in jail or 240 hours of community service
– Up to 1 year in jail
– Minimum 5-year license revocation if within 20 years
– Mandatory BAIID installation
Aggravated DUI (Felony) – Prison time starting at 1 year
– Longer license revocation periods
– Substantially higher fines
– Additional penalties if child passengers, injury, or death involved
Statutory Summary Suspension – Automatic license suspension for 6 to 12 months
– Can occur even before conviction
– Can be challenged in a separate hearing
CDL DUI – CDL disqualification for at least 1 year on first offense
– Lifetime disqualification for second offense
– BAC limit of 0.04% for commercial drivers

The Long-Term Impact of a DUI in Burbank, IL

A DUI conviction in Burbank, IL carries consequences that can follow you for life. Under Illinois law, DUI offenses remain on your criminal record permanently and are not eligible for record sealing or expungement.

Even after the court case ends, the repercussions may continue. Many drivers encounter higher insurance rates, including possible SR-22 filing requirements, difficulties with employment or professional licensing, and ongoing restrictions tied to their driving privileges.

Driver’s License Suspension and Reinstatement After a DUI in Burbank, IL

A DUI arrest in Burbank, IL can lead to an immediate administrative suspension of your driver’s license under Illinois’ Statutory Summary Suspension system. This penalty is separate from the criminal case and may take effect even before the court determines guilt or innocence. The suspension is typically triggered if a driver fails a chemical test or refuses to take one after being arrested for DUI in Burbank, IL. These tests commonly include breath, blood, or urine analysis used to measure impairment.

Understanding Statutory Summary Suspension in Burbank, IL

  • Failed BAC Test (.08% or higher): Your driver’s license is automatically suspended for 6 months.
  • Testing Refusal: Declining a breath, blood, or urine test triggers a one-year license suspension.
  • CDL Holders: Commercial drivers may face immediate CDL disqualification, even if the Burbank, IL DUI arrest occurred while operating a personal vehicle.

You have the right to contest the suspension by filing a Petition to Rescind. This petition must be submitted within 90 days of receiving the suspension notice or before your first scheduled court appearance—whichever occurs earlier.

After the petition is filed, the court must schedule a hearing within 30 days of the filing date or within 30 days of the first court appearance—whichever occurs later. If the hearing is not held within that timeframe, the suspension may be automatically lifted.

Steps to Reinstate Your Driver’s License in Burbank, IL

If your driver’s license has been suspended after a DUI arrest, a knowledgeable Burbank, IL DUI lawyer can help you pursue options to regain your driving privileges. This may include:

  • Preparing and filing the necessary documents to challenge the suspension.
  • Advocating for you at reinstatement or administrative hearings.
  • Applying for a Monitoring Device Driving Permit (MDDP), which may allow restricted driving with a BAIID device.
  • Guiding you through the formal reinstatement process once your suspension period ends.

Taking action quickly in Burbank, IL can significantly improve your chances of reducing the amount of time you are unable to legally drive.

Combs Waterkotte’s DUI Defense Strategies in Burbank, IL

A DUI arrest in Burbank, IL does not guarantee a conviction. A skilled DUI defense lawyer in Burbank, IL will carefully analyze the evidence, identify weaknesses in the State’s case, and develop a strategy designed to challenge the allegations and safeguard your future. Effective DUI defense strategies in Burbank, IL often include:

Examining Whether the Traffic Stop Was Lawful in Burbank, IL

Law enforcement must have a lawful basis to initiate a traffic stop in Burbank, IL. If the officer lacked reasonable suspicion—such as specific observations of impaired driving, a traffic violation, or other articulable facts—any evidence obtained after the stop may be subject to suppression. When a stop is unconstitutional, the entire Burbank, IL case can be significantly weakened or dismissed.

Disputing Field Sobriety Test Results in Burbank, IL

Field sobriety tests are often treated as evidence of impairment, but they are far from perfect. Factors such as stress, physical injuries, balance issues, uneven pavement, poor weather conditions, or improper instructions from officers can influence performance. A DUI defense lawyer in Burbank, IL may challenge whether these tests were conducted correctly and whether the results truly indicate impairment.

Questioning the Reliability of Chemical Tests in Burbank, IL

Breath and blood tests in Burbank, IL must comply with strict procedural and maintenance requirements. Devices must be properly calibrated, testing must be conducted by qualified personnel, and timelines must be followed precisely. Errors in administration, equipment malfunction, or improper handling can compromise the reliability of BAC results.

Countering Allegations of Physical Impairment

Police reports frequently rely on subjective indicators like slurred speech, bloodshot eyes, the smell of alcohol, or unsteady movements. However, these symptoms can also result from fatigue, allergies, illness, medication, or stressful circumstances. A strong DUI defense in Burbank, IL, questions whether these observations actually prove impairment.

Raising Constitutional Challenges

If law enforcement officers violated your constitutional protections in Burbank, IL—such as conducting an unlawful search, detaining you without legal justification, failing to issue Miranda warnings, or making an improper arrest—your attorney may seek to exclude that evidence through motions to suppress. When key evidence is removed, the prosecution’s case can weaken significantly.

Negotiating for Reduced Penalties or Alternative Sentencing

If a full dismissal is not achievable, a DUI defense attorney in Burbank, IL may negotiate with prosecutors to reduce the charge—such as seeking reckless driving—or pursue sentencing options that reduce penalties and limit the long-term consequences on your record.

Next Steps: What to Do After a DUI Arrest in Burbank, IL

The decisions you make immediately after a DUI arrest in Burbank, IL can directly impact your criminal case and your ability to protect your driving privileges. Taking the right steps early can make a meaningful difference in the outcome.

Step 1: Do Not Rush to Plead Guilty

After a DUI arrest in Burbank, IL, many people assume a conviction is inevitable. It is not. The prosecution must prove every element of the charge beyond a reasonable doubt, just like any other criminal case. Before entering any plea or making statements in court, consult with an experienced Burbank, IL DUI defense attorney to understand your options.

Step 2: Be Aware of Your Options Regarding Testing in Burbank, IL

Law enforcement officers often request field sobriety tests and chemical testing to collect evidence of impairment. In Burbank, IL, some drivers choose to decline these tests unless a warrant is issued. While refusing testing may result in an automatic license suspension, that suspension can still be challenged through legal proceedings. Understanding your rights and the potential consequences is an important part of building your defense.

Step 3: Contact a DUI Defense Lawyer in Burbank, IL Immediately

The sooner you involve a Burbank, IL DUI defense attorney, the more options you may have to fight the charges. Early legal intervention allows your lawyer to investigate the traffic stop, challenge administrative license suspensions, and begin building a defense strategy before the prosecution’s case progresses further.

Step 4: Save Any Evidence That Could Support Your Burbank, IL Defense

Keep any information that may support your defense, including receipts, Burbank, IL location data, text messages, witness contact information, or documentation of medical conditions that could affect testing results. Small details can become important later.

Step 5: Follow Your Burbank, IL DUI Lawyer’s Strategy

DUI cases in Burbank, IL often involve strict timelines and multiple legal proceedings. Stay in regular communication with your attorney, appear at all scheduled court hearings, and follow the defense strategy carefully to give your case the strongest possible chance of success.
